Understanding coolant leaks coolant is an essential fluid That is, if you do not have the right amount of fluid, you are asking for serious trouble that may include substantial engine damage As such, you should routinely check your car's coolant levels If you regularly find that you are adding new fluid to your system, there is a good chance you have a coolant leak

How to find and fix leaking radiators on trucks a truck radiator leak repair can be a very tricky job Many drivers, who find a slow radiator coolant leak, will often decide just to add some fluid and leave it, with the intention of taking care of it at a later time
Unfortunately, ignoring a heavy duty truck radiator leak can become a very costly decision if delayed too long or not watched. Finding a coolant leak in your truck can be a daunting task, but it's essential to address any leaks promptly to prevent engine damage
